NAPPS Education Summit: Meet the Discussants, Most Rev. Prof. Igwebuike Onah, Ikeje Asogwa

By Chetanne Chinelo, Enugu

Advertisement

As the Education summit to be organized by the Enugu State Chapter of the National Association of Proprietors of Private Schools, NAPPS, in conjunction with the Enugu State Ministry of Education, continues to get closer, the Executive Chairman of the Enugu State Universal Basic Education Board (ENSUBEB), Chief Ikeje Asogwa, has been tipped to be one of the Summit’s discussants. The other is the Catholic Bishop of Nsukka Diocese, Most Rev. Prof. Igwebuike Onah.

Recall that the Summit will seat about 3000 teachers, including principals and heads of schools from both the private and public schools in Enugu State.

Chief Ikeje Asogwa

Chief Ikeje Asogwa was formally an Estate manager in the private sector and was appointed as the Managing Director of Enugu State Housing Development Cooperation (ESHDC) by former Governor of Enugu State, Sullivan Chime. He later became the Enugu State People’s Democratic Party Chairman. He would later be appointed the Executive Chairman of ENSUBEB by Governor Ifeanyi Ugwuanyi, a position he holds till date.

Most Rev. Prof. Igwebuike Onah

Most. Rev. Prof. Igwebuike Onah is famed for his intellectual prowess and general resourcefulness as a Professor of Philosophical Anthropology, Deputy Vice-Chancellor (Vice-Rector) of the Pontifical Urban University, Rome and Consultor to the Secretariat of the Synod of Bishops, Vatican City. He serves as the Chairman of the Governing Councils and Pro-Chancellor of two Universities, namely Enugu State University of Science and Technology (ESUT), Enugu and Veritas University of Nigeria (VUNA), Abuja.

The Summit hosted by Enugu NAPPS and co-hosted by the Ministry of Education is scheduled for Tuesday, March 1, 2022 at The Base Event Center, and Wednesday, March 2, 2022 at Law Faculty Auditorium, UNEC, Enugu, by 10am daily.

Panelists in the Summit are
Rev. Fr. Prof. Christian Anieke, VC, GO University,
Evang. Favour Ugwuanyi, Permanent Secretary, PPSMB
Mrs. Stella Adibe, Proprietor, Spring of Life Schools
Chukwuma Ephraim Okenwa, Executive Director, LEAD Network
